Why People Love Puns
People love puns because they are simple brain surprises. Your mind expects one thing, but gets another. That tiny twist creates instant humor and joy.
Puns also make communication playful, easy, and memorable, especially for kids learning language and humor.

Valentines Day Knock Knock Jokes for Kids
Knock knock jokes are classic and perfect for kids of all ages.
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Olive. Olive who? Olive you forever
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Lettuce. Lettuce who? Lettuce be Valentine’s
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Honey. Honey who? Honey I love you
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Ice cream. Ice cream who? Ice cream for you
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Cow. Cow who? Cow me your Valentine
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Hug. Hug who? Hug me please
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Heart. Heart who? Heart you forever
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Bee. Bee who? Bee my Valentine
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Orange. Orange who? Orange you glad I love you
- Knock knock. Who’s there? Peas. Peas who? Peas be mine
